Oct 1880 - Dec 1905*
Lucy S McSpadden the daughter of Samuel M. McSpadden and Elizabeth J. (Rudolph) McSpadden. Lucy was just 24 when she died.
My grandmother Ada (Dobbs) Collier kept a picture of her fiend, Lucy and I have it today.**
*This old stone is hard to read.
